About THE PENDERELS TRUST LIMITED
THE PENDERELS TRUST LIMITED is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1073513).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Platinum" rating with a CharityScore of 95/100 — one of the highest-rated charities in England and Wales for governance and transparency. This places it among the top-rated charities in our database, reflecting strong performance across governance, financial health, and regulatory compliance. In its most recent reporting year (2025), THE PENDERELS TRUST LIMITED reported a total income of £9,459,820 and total expenditure of £7,749,963, a spending ratio of 82% indicating a strong proportion of funds directed to charitable work. According to the Charity Commission register, THE PENDERELS TRUST LIMITED describes its activities as follows: Support disabled people, carers and older people to live independently in the community, and to participate in that community. Our analysis found no significant governance concerns for THE PENDERELS TRUST LIMITED. No regulatory actions, filing failures, or financial anomalies were detected in the available public data.
